Hedge planting services involve the installation of dense, living barriers made up of shrubs or small trees designed to define property boundaries, enhance privacy, and improve curb appeal. These services typically include selecting appropriate plant varieties suited to the local climate and soil conditions, preparing the site, and carefully planting to ensure healthy growth. Whether for a residential yard or a commercial property, professional hedge planting can create a natural screen that adds both aesthetic value and functional privacy to outdoor spaces.
Many property owners turn to hedge planting services to address common issues such as unwanted visibility from neighbors, noise reduction, or wind protection. Over time, unmanaged or poorly maintained hedges can become overgrown, sparse, or uneven, diminishing their effectiveness and visual appeal. Professional contractors can help establish new hedges or rejuvenate existing ones, ensuring they grow densely and evenly, providing consistent privacy and noise buffering. This service is also useful for creating visual boundaries that add structure and definition to outdoor areas.

The overview below groups typical Hedge Planting proj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Palm City, FL.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Smaller Hedge Planting - Many local contractors charge between $250 and $600 for planting a small hedge, which typically involves a few dozen plants along a garden border. These projects are common for homeowners looking to add privacy or decorative greenery on a modest scale.
Medium-Sized Hedge Installation - For more extensive hedges covering larger areas, costs generally range from $1,000 to $3,000. This price includes preparing the site, planting dozens to hundreds of plants, and basic maintenance considerations.
Large or Complex Hedge Projects - Larger, more intricate hedge installations, such as those involving specialized plants or landscape integration, can range from $3,500 to $8,000 or more. While fewer projects fall into this high tier, local pros can handle customized and sizable hedge planting jobs.
Full Hedge Replacement - Replacing an existing hedge with new plants typically costs between $600 and $2,500, depending on the length and height of the hedge. Many routine replacements land in the middle of this range, with larger or more detailed work reaching higher costs.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What types of hedge plants are suitable for Palm City, FL? Local service providers can recommend a variety of hedge plants that thrive in the Palm City climate, including species like viburnum, boxwood, and ligustrum, based on your landscape needs.
How can I choose the right hedge planting service? Consider checking the experience of local contractors with hedge installation, reviewing their past work, and ensuring they understand the specific requirements of your property in Palm City.
What are common considerations when planting hedges in this area? Local pros typically assess soil condition, sunlight exposure, and water availability to ensure the selected hedge plants establish properly and grow healthily.
Can hedge planting help with privacy in Palm City neighborhoods? Yes, experienced local contractors can help design and install hedge screens that enhance privacy while complementing the landscape style of properties in the area.
What maintenance is involved after hedge planting? Service providers can advise on pruning, watering, and care routines to keep hedges healthy and attractive over time in the Palm City environment.
